Light-scattering tools at SPb Univ. and modelling of IS extinction and polarization

Author(s): Vladimir Il'in, Victor Farafonov

Presenter: Vladimir Il'in (St. Petersburg University)

We make a brief overview of the light-scattering codes developed by our group as well as outline our near-future plans. Our most advanced codes treat homogeneous spheroids and core-mantle ones with the confocal boundaries of the layers and provide both various cross-sections and scattering matrix. In our plans are rewriting the codes in C or contemporary Fortran and implantation of the treatment of multi-layered spheroids with non-confocal boundaries of layers.
We also discuss modelling of the interstellar extinction and polarization. We note the problems of such modelling, its current state and some perspectives. We list the main results of our modelling works performed for the last 10 years and outline possible steps forward and applications.
